DPD has denied that it is currently considering opening a fifth hub in 2018-20.

The parcel carrier, which recently received planning permission to develop its 330,000 ft² East Midlands hub in Hinckley, Leicestershire, said it has not yet set out plans for expansion beyond the investments planned over the next two to three years.

A spokesman for the carrier said: “There are no firm plans beyond that at this stage but clearly if we continue to grow at our current rate, then our investment programme will continue too.”

DPD was responding to a media report suggesting a fifth site for the carrier was go.

The Hinckley hub is expected to increase DPD’s overall sorting capacity by 65% and is hoped to be operational in 2015.
